Ex-Sugababes singer Mutya Buena has denied claims that the original line-up are reuniting.
Keisha Buchanan, Siobhán Donaghy and Buena were recently reportedly working on new material and were set to record with the Xenomania songwriting and production team (Girls Aloud, Kylie Minogue, Pet Shop Boys) as well as their old producer Cameron McVey, who worked on their 2000 album 'One Touch' and Siobhán Donaghy's debut album 'Revolution In Me' (2003).
But Buena has taken to her Twitter page Twitter.com/originalmutyab, denying any plans that she is set to record with her fellow band members and is apparently concentrating on new solo material.
She wrote:
No track [with] Keisha or Professor G, he was around the studio. I'm just working on my stuff at the moment.
The original Sugababes line-up formed in 1998 and released their debut album 'One Touch' in 2000. Donaghy left the band in 2001 and was replaced by Heidi Range. Buena departed in 2005 to be replaced by Amelle Berrabah and Buchanan was last to leave in 2009, with Jade Ewan stepping into her shoes.

According to reports, Mutya Keisha Siobhan – or: the group originally known as the Sugababes – have been dropped by Polydor.
We understand from a source that the group were dropped several weeks ago after disputes with management and a poor chart performance for comeback single ‘Flatline’, which only reached #50 in the UK singles charts. MKS have put on a brave face since, performing a cover of Lorde’s ‘Royals’ for Google+ Sessions at the start of October, but fans seem to have cottoned on to the news: Polydor are currently receiving tweets from angry MKS fans, and users on Pop Justice‘s forum are also discussing it. We’ve requested official confirmation from Polydor.

Mutya Buena has told Digital Spy that she is open to taking back the Sugababes name.
The 28-year-old is recording with original bandmates Keisha Buchanan and Siobhan Donaghy under the name MKS, though it would appear the Sugababes name is no longer in use after Jade Ewen revealed to DS that the current line-up of herself, Heidi Range and Amelle Berrabah split two years ago.

Speaking to us at Disney's 'Share the Magic' Christmas party on Oxford Street last night (November 6), Buena said that she is keeping "an open mind" about becoming the Sugababes again.
"You never say never," she said. "I think you should always have an open mind. And it is our name!"
Buena currently owns rights to use the Sugababes name on paper, cardboard and goods made from these materials, stationery and gift wrapping products.
The singer also claimed that she is not worried about MKS's debut track 'Flatline' only reaching 50 in the UK singles chart.

"I'm happy, and I love the song," she said. "I think it's probably one of the best songs we've ever done.
"It's not always about chart positions, it's about having fans that love your music and we've got such dedicated fans.
"We're able to go out and release music and feel like, 'Oh God, we never made it to number one'. I really didn't care if it went to number one or number 100. I just wanted people to recognise we were back together and we were enjoying ourselves."

Asked why she thought buzz about MKS and 'Flatline' hadn't transferred into more sales, Buena replied: "There wasn't a lot of promotion, to tell you the truth. And it came out on a Friday and charted on the Sunday - when does that give you enough time to promote your music?
"But you know what, I thought we did well. I'm looking towards the tour and coming back next year with the album and more singles."

Are MKS the original Sugababes heading for another split after Mutya Keisha Siobhan email row?
Speculation of strife in Suga-land mounted earlier this week when Keisha Buchanan sent a highly public tweet to Mutya casting doubts on the trio's future
After becoming more known for their backbiting and revolving door policy on membership, the original trio - expunged from the official line-up - decided to reform and it was all supposed to be different this time around.
The original three - the imaginatively-titled Mutya Keisha Siobhan - got back together, released a single and went on a sold-out tour across the UK but it seems that all is not well in the land of Suga.
With their debut single Flatline er - flatlining in the charts, managing to peak at just number 50 - rumours had been swirling that the band's much-anticipated comeback was a dud and that they were due to be dropped by their record label.
That was swiftly denied but now new speculation of trouble has swept social networks following a suspect tweet that Keisha Buchanan sent to bandmate Mutya Buena.
"@MutyaBuena Hello???????!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!! Clearly I have to start tweeting you," the Round Round singer wrote in a highly public fashion.
Then on one of Mutya's Instagram photos, bandmate Keisha wrote: "EMAILS!!!!!!!!!! Work???????????????? @mutyabuena hello ????"
Meanwhile third member Siobhan is enjoying a lovely holiday, apparently blissfully unaware of all the drama.
Hmmm. What could this mean? Could the band that splits up more than a reality show fauxmance be in trouble?
Well - don't panic because it seems not. Keisha later deleted her tweet and comments to Real Girl singer Mutya and wrote: "Guys chill lol all is wonderful with me & my sisters woohsahhhh not that deep".
Mutya added her own explanation, writing: "Nothing's goin on dnt worry no red Alerts everyone's on holiday at the moment ..... I'm chillin with family fones on silent"
The group's publicist also denied there was an issue, saying in a statement to 3am online: "There’s nothing going on here. The band will be releasing their second single and their album later this year."

Mutya, Keisha and indeed Siobhan, aka Mutya Keisha Siobhan, will be performing at next week’s NME Awards, it is our pleasure to exclusively reveal.
The ladies will be performing with Metronomy on a version of the latter’s current single, ‘Love Letters’.
The awards take place at the Brixton Academy on February 26 and will also feature a performance by Blondie and Popjustice favourites Drenge.
